According to John Smith, a CNC technician with over a decade of experience, “Precision starts with the right calibration. Operators must regularly check and calibrate their CNC machine tools to maintain accuracy. Even minimal deviations can lead to significant errors in the finished product.” This highlights the need for stringent maintenance routines and the importance of initial setup processes.
Building on this, Linda Johnson, a manufacturing engineer, emphasizes the role of software in achieving precision. “With advancements in CNC programming, operators can utilize simulation software to preemptively identify potential issues before they occur in production. This proactive approach helps in reducing both errors and downtime.” Optimization through the right software tools can greatly enhance the efficiency of CNC operations.
Downtime is a primary concern in any production environment. Mark Thompson, a production manager, notes that, “One of the biggest contributors to downtime is unexpected machine failure. Regular preventive maintenance schedules can catch potential issues before they lead to malfunction. It’s essential to invest in quality components and training for operators, ensuring they can perform basic troubleshooting.”

Moreover, Jason Lee, a CNC consultant, offers practical advice, stating, “Implementing a detailed tracking system can vastly improve accountability in operations. By keeping records of machine performance and maintenance, operators can identify trends that lead to equipment failure, allowing predefined measures to be taken to prevent it.” Effective data management can play a crucial role in sustaining operational efficiency.
Training is a vital factor in ensuring precision and reducing downtime. Emily Clarke, a senior trainer, argues, “Operators who are well-trained in both software and machinery not only work more efficiently but also make fewer mistakes. A knowledgeable operator can spot potential issues on CNC machine tools before they escalate, translating into smooth operations.” Continuous education and skill enhancement should be part of every CNC operation’s culture.
Furthermore, collaboration among workers is key. “Encouraging a teamwork environment leads to better communication about machine status and potential problems. It reduces individual mistakes and promotes shared accountability,” adds Roberto Martinez, a CNC workshop leader. By leveraging collective knowledge, teams can work more effectively and efficiently.
